Statistics on carers in Australia

Statistics taken from the Australian Bureau of Statistics publication Disability, Ageing and Carers, Australia: Summary of Findings, 2003. This publication presents a summary of results from the Survey of Disability, Ageing and Carers (SDAC) conducted by the Australian Bureau of Statistics (ABS) throughout Australia, from June to November 2003.

The SDAC was also conducted in 1998 and this publication presents some comparisons with this survey. The 2003 SDAC was largely a repeat of the 1998 survey, with some additions to content in the areas of cognitive and emotional support, and computer and Internet use.

Carer characteristics

1998 2003
Number All Carers 2,327,900 (12.6% of total population) 2,557,000 (13% of total population)
Primary Carers 450,900 (2.4% of total population, 19.4% of all carers) 474,600 (2.4% of total population, 18.6% of all carers)
Gender All Carers Male: 1,021,700 (44%)
Male: 1,174,600 (46%)
Female: 1,306,200 (56%) Female: 1,382,300 (54%)
Primary Carers Male: 133,500 (30%)
Male: 136,200 (29%)
Female: 317,300 (70%) Female: 338,400 (71%)
